Output 3e4afff522b8a16cf387f1c2e0de29a47d7b77827946874bccf2e3d0fb70f246:8

value
231426081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ec19ea98ac06166e970c0a74d38e4aa8ea956254 OP_EQUAL
address
3PDQSX1ZJvRAPNzTxpC4ixUi5iNaCtkRpF
transaction
3e4afff522b8a16cf387f1c2e0de29a47d7b77827946874bccf2e3d0fb70f246
spent
true